Default Front and Rear Different Tires question!!

Is there any negative effect of having a different brand/tread pattern for front and rears?

Like running Falken 452 235/30/20 up fronts and running Yoko S Drive 275/30/20 at the rears??

All tires are new....Just wondering because Yoko is much cheaper than Falken

Btw speed rating and tread wear are the same...

In general you should have all 4 of the same tire model on the vehicle. If it is impossible to do because the tire has been discontinued or something then at the very least get the same speed rating and never mix on the same axel.
